About The Leopard

Giuseppe Tomasi di Lampedusa's The Leopard (1958) is the great novel of Sicily — Don Fabrizio Corbera watching the unification of Italy destroy the world he was born into. Written by a man who never published fiction before and died before seeing it in print, The Leopard is one of the supreme achievements of Italian literature and the essential novel of a civilization's twilight.
